Nepal Drains Dangerous Everest Lake

Nepal’s army says it has finished draining a dangerous glacial lake near Mount Everest to a safe level.

The Imja glacial lake, at nearly 5,000m (16,400ft) high, was in danger of flooding downstream settlements, trekking trails and bridges. Imja is one of thousands of glacial lakes in the Himalayas.

The lake, which was originally 149m deep in places, has had its water levels lowered by 3.4m after months of painstaking work, officials say. To read more, please click on the link below:
